"Violence against teachers must stop" Sadtu


 The SA Democratic Teachers' Union says violence against teachers must stop.

This was one of the resolutions adopted after a meeting of the union's national general council in Kempton Park at the weekend.
SADTU said in a statement that the harshest sentence should be meted out on any person who attacks teachers and all other education workers at schools.

The union called for the creation of a national violence against teachers registry and for research to be conducted at schools where such incidents occurred.

SADTU's General Secretary Mugwena Maluleke also wished the Grade 12 class of 2013 good luck for the matric exams.

"We call on society and in particular the parents to support these learners during this time let us afford them enough time and space to prepare for this examination, We further urge our students to focus on their preparations and avoid unnecessary distraction" he said
